Sauruck is a peak in Waldmünchen, Cham, Bavaria and has an elevation of 706 metres. Sauruck is situated nearby to the village Machtesberg, as well as near the hamlet Lengau.Places of Interest

Geigant station is a railway station in the Geigant district in the municipality of Waldmünchen, located in the Cham district in Bavaria, Germany.
